Transaction 2e77ed3392bdf27d8907eb908e90455454357b5cd032c144d6bf6d6b4bf9be0b
2 Input
2 Outputs
- 2e77ed3392bdf27d8907eb908e90455454357b5cd032c144d6bf6d6b4bf9be0b:0
- 2e77ed3392bdf27d8907eb908e90455454357b5cd032c144d6bf6d6b4bf9be0b:1
value 2591403143
address 366DExKPBFqBVJwFvV4LxvYD6viopCZ43x
value 908453414
address 1CDwH2FSxsXMzHqZwqLWgDn35VWHHcULiC